Parasabhadar in context

With 359 people at the 2011 Census, Parasabhadar was the 512th most populous of its district's 668 villages, below the district average of 863.

Literacy stood at 48.86%, 7.2 points below the district's rural average of 56.04%.

The sex ratio was 1112 women per 1,000 men (88 above the district's rural figure of 1024)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1364, 441 above the rural national 923.
